Flash CS3 now crashes randomly after 0-30 minutes
Hello,
I've been using flash CS3 for years without problem.
Since the beginning of nov.2010, it crashes after some time of use. More precisely the toolbar disappears, then reappears, some GUI elements blink. It's not related to a specific user action. When this happens, closing flash is difficult (the window remains here). When switching to another app, some Flash parts remains. The graphical memory seems saturated. Launching another app is met with a window error message. A windows restarts becomes necessary.
This problem arises only in Flash, and with no other apps from CS3 suite.
2 colleagues of mine has the same issue, also in the last weeks (= nov 2010). We work in separate places. We didn't exchange files.
We are on Win XP Home Edition, Dell computer.
They have more recent PCs than mine (which clearly meets the CS3 requirements), with enough memory,etc..
One colleague has reinstalled winXP. The problem arised again, but I don't know when. He also tried CS4 and CS5 and had the same problem.
Today he un-installed all Adobe products with this utility: http://www.adobe.com/support/contact/cs5clean.html.
After this hour of uninstall process, he reinstalled Flash CS3 and used it without network/internet (no funky updates): The problem was still here.
Does anyone has an idea?After desinstalling Avira Antivir (and installing another antivirus software), the problem disappeared.
Just disabling Antivir is not enough.

Free Transform/Rotate Causes Flash CS3 to Crash
This problem is driving me nuts. I'm importing a 2000 x 3000
jpeg image and converting it to a symbol. everything seems fine
until I try to do a free transform and rotate the image. Then when
I proceed to cut the image, CS3 crashes. I can reproduce the error
every time. It works fine if the image is smaller but 2000 x 3000
is not too much to ask at all!
Has anyone else had similar problems?
I can reproduce this error on a Mac and a PC.
UPDATE: Breaking the bitmap apart after importing the image
seems to remedy the problem. Is this the only fix? Doesn't seem
right to me that I can't just easily drop in an semi-large asset
without having to break it apart.
UPDATE 2: Tried doing this with a larger asset and this did
not work at all. It crashes, I feel like Flash has a hard time with
large assets but I need the assets large so when I zoom in, I do
not lose quality. What am I doing wrong here? How do you guys
handle your zoom ins?
